On 16/01/2019 14:34, Linjie Fu wrote: > hrd_buffer_size and hrd_initial_buffer_fullness are set in bits, while > driver takes the vbvBuf size in 16 kbits. The mismatch will cause > quality issue. > > One way to solve this issue in FFmpeg level is set the bufsize > specially for mpeg2 as the unit of 16 kbits, and discard the default > CBR mode in driver. > > Fix the quality issue in #7650. > > Signed-off-by: Linjie Fu <linjie.fu@intel.com> > --- > libavcodec/vaapi_encode.c | 8 +++++--- > 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-) The documentation is very clear that these values are all in bits - <https://github.com/intel/libva/blob/master/va/va.h#L2095-L2100>. Sounds like a driver bug? - Mark

hrd_buffer_size and hrd_initial_buffer_fullness are set in bits, while driver takes the vbvBuf size in 16 kbits. The mismatch will cause quality issue. One way to solve this issue in FFmpeg level is set the bufsize specially for mpeg2 as the unit of 16 kbits, and discard the default CBR mode in driver. Fix the quality issue in #7650.
